The new mechanism entails an added cost of 38 euros per coach per day, comprising 35 euros for the concession permit and three more for the mandatory reservation. This measure, proposed in the 2025 fiscal ordinances, takes effect this Monday and is added to the 20 euros companies already paid in 2024.
According to the council, the main goal of Zona Bus 4.0 is to distribute vehicles more efficiently to reduce congestion in stopping areas. The system sets an hourly parking limit on the busiest roads and introduces mandatory online reservation for all operators.
Reservation is essential for parking or brief stops in eight high-demand locations. These include the areas surrounding the Sagrada Família, Park Güell, La Pedrera, the Hospital de Sant Pau, the Drassanes, the Ciutat Vella district, the Port Olímpic, and the Magic Fountain of Montjuïc.
In total, the city of Barcelona has 210 spaces requiring this prior reservation, 159 of which are designated for long-term parking and 51 for short stops. Before its implementation, over a thousand permits had already been issued through the new system.
